From 932d055d8e1ce9ad347d11cd58066d1372e81d79 Mon Sep 17 00:00:00 2001 From: ashilkn Date: Thu, 15 Sep 2022 16:34:33 +0530 Subject: [PATCH] change return type of cacheKey() to non-nullable --- lib/models/ente_file.dart | 2 +- lib/models/file.dart | 3 +-- 2 files changed, 2 insertions(+), 3 deletions(-) diff --git a/lib/models/ente_file.dart b/lib/models/ente_file.dart index a0eedfdb9..5025bc4d6 100644 --- a/lib/models/ente_file.dart +++ b/lib/models/ente_file.dart @@ -4,5 +4,5 @@ abstract class EnteFile { // returns cacheKey which should be used while caching entry related to // this file. - String? cacheKey(); + String cacheKey(); } diff --git a/lib/models/file.dart b/lib/models/file.dart index 0b87963c9..599058563 100644 --- a/lib/models/file.dart +++ b/lib/models/file.dart @@ -275,9 +275,8 @@ class File extends EnteFile { } @override - //add nullable return type when migrating to null safety String cacheKey() { // todo: Neeraj: 19thJuly'22: evaluate and add fileHash as the key? - return localID ?? uploadedFileID?.toString() ?? generatedID?.toString(); + return localID ?? uploadedFileID?.toString() ?? generatedID.toString(); } }